**** SPOILER ALERT ****
For that part, you are supposed to go up on to the top (where it looks like
you deadend), and there is a big giant crate or piece of machinery. You drag it and then push it over the edge to the area below near where the helicopter blocked you off. It will crash through a big glass panel on the floor, and then you can drop down into there.
